iPhone 6 Plus支持字体问题

3

我正在为我的应用程序添加对 iPhone 6 的支持。 由于该应用程序也运行在 iOS7 上,因此我不想使用 Size Classes。 我打算使用自动布局来定位视图,但我不确定如何处理字体大小。 我想在 iPhone 6 Plus 上将某些字体变大。 如何在不使用 Size Classes 的情况下使用自动布局实现这一点?


也许编写一些代码来增大字体大小会有所帮助?... - Fahri Azimov
我正在尝试避免这样的代码,例如if iPhone5,if iPhone6,iPhone6Plus。 - YogevSitton
这将完全违背自动布局的初衷。 - YogevSitton
我正在尝试避免像if iPhone5,if iPhone6,iPhone6Plus这样的代码。 - YogevSitton
对我来说,最快的解决方案是添加一些代码,使字体大小相对于其标签边界自适应。这很容易且不依赖设备,就像如果明天有一个50英寸屏幕的iPhone 9,只要标签视图边界正确,这段代码仍然可以工作。 - Coldsteel48
显示剩余3条评论
1个回答

0

你可以使用尺寸类来支持iOS7,这是Xcode的相关功能,可以帮助你设计应用程序的行为。

获取最新版本的Xcode,将部署目标设置为iOS7,并开始使用尺寸类设计你的ViewController


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接